[Wien] DOS Problems and tetra using intel ifc8.1 -r8 option

fecher fecher at mail.uni-mainz.de
Tue Oct 26 14:34:42 CEST 2004


It seems that the problem to calculate the DOS is related to the fact that 
some variables in tetra.f are declared as real*4, but only in tetra.f and not 
in the subroutines  that are called (here some variables are not declared !? 
and implictit set), -r8 will set implicit to real*8, so that the type of the 
variables is not the same in tetra.f and some subroutines.

The same may appear in joint where also some variables are declared as Real*4.

Is it really necessary that those variables are real*4 ? Or does everything 
work fine if those are declared as real*8 ?

Ciao Gerhard




More information about the Wien mailing list